Many people just pop down to a neighborhood store and select up the 1st fan they see, but there are a handful of things you must consider about bathroom fans prior to you get.
What size bathroom fan do you need? For most bathrooms, a four" (100mm) fan is adequate, and is indeed the common. If you are seeking to change an present bathroom fan, and do not know what dimension it is, will not measure the front! The measurement is taken from the back of the fan, and it is the diameter of the spigot, or pipe, which protrudes from the back of the fan that demands to be measured. If you cannot get rid of the fan, (you need to get a experienced electrician to do it) it is possibly a four" a single. A six" extractor fan is not typically needed for a bathroom. They are normally much more powerful and only necessary for kitchens.
In my view, the two most critical factors you should be hunting at are the extract fee of the bathroom fan, and the decibel level of the fan. Obviously the greatest situation is a extremely effective fan with a very lower decibel degree. These seem to be to the two elements in a fan which are ignored the most! A great deal of men and women seem to go just on appears, and believe that all bathroom fans are generally the same�.huge blunder! four" supporters variety from an extract charge of 54m3 per hour (the minimal degree needed by creating regulations) up to 118m3 per hour. For a normal bathroom I would advocate anything from about 75m3 per hour, and if you get plenty of baths or showers, producing lots of condensation. then anything at all over 90m3 per hour ought to so the task.
But as I say, search out for the decibel degree of the fan, as a noisy bathroom fan can be notably irritating, specially when you are possessing a great comforting bath! As a guide, anything under 25dB is considered extremely quiet. 35 dB would be classified as mid-variety, and 45dB or over noisy.
Yet another issue that could be taken into consideration is the volume of power that a bathroom fan makes use of. These days, you can get what are typically classified as "lower-watt" bathroom followers, with power utilization levers of 5-10 watts. Nevertheless, even an previous fashioned bathroom fan normally makes use of no far more than 30w, and when you take into account how short a time they are normally on for, the expense variation in running these supporters is only pence per month. I would not target on this is a main stage to think about in your acquire.
